More source of controversy?[edit]

I just read this on Sports Illustrated online: "At Colorado, under the God-fearing Bill McCartney (who would leave coaching after the 1994 season to found the Christian men's group Promise Keepers), Buffaloes football players ran amok to such a degree that a school policeman told SI's Rick Reilly, "At the first home football game of every season, a couple of detectives drop by the stadium and pick up a few programs. Saves you time. Instead of having a victim go through the mug book, you just take out your program and say, 'Is he in here?'""[1] Is there more on these issues and should they be integrated into criticisms? --Bobak 17:11, 2 August 2006 (UTC)[reply]
